‘Blur Mirror’ appears as a traditional looking glass, yet as a viewer approaches their reflection is blurred. Their surroundings remain in focus, yet they are continually censored even as they move in front of the glass.

The piece is an observation on censorship and ownership of image in the digital age, amid global extremes of data transparency and suppression.

The mirror surface is made up of 1000 individual squares each held by an individually controllable custom mount, which delivers highly tuned vibrational movement in order to blur the image reflected on its mirror’s surface.

Mirrors, custom vibration mounts, custom motion tracking software, camera, computer

 

2400mm x 1140mm x 260mm
